Rapper Offset Hospitalized After Shooting at Florida Casino Valet

Rapper Offset is recovering in a Florida hospital after being shot outside a Hollywood casino on Saturday evening, according to his representative.

Offset, whose real name is Kiari Kendrell Cephus, was shot in the valet area of the Seminole Hard Rock Hotel and Casino around 7 p.m. on April 6. His spokesperson confirmed to TMZ that the Migos rapper is "stable and being closely monitored" at the hospital with non-life threatening injuries.

"The situation was contained quickly," a Seminole County Police spokesperson told media. "The site is secure and there is no threat to the public. Operations continue as normal."

Authorities have made two arrests in connection with the shooting, though details about suspects or motives remain undisclosed as the investigation continues.

The 34-year-old artist, who shares three children with ex-wife Cardi B and has three other children from previous relationships, is expected to make a full recovery.

This incident marks another tragic connection to gun violence for the Migos hip-hop collective. In 2022, Offset's bandmate Takeoff was fatally shot outside a Houston club at age 28. Offset has previously spoken about the difficulty of processing that loss.

"It's hard for me to talk about this stuff," Offset told Variety in 2023 regarding Takeoff's death. "That s--t hurts. I get through my day thinking it's fake."

Despite the traumatic event, medical professionals indicate Offset's injuries are not life-threatening, and he remains under close observation at the hospital.
